ATMs resorting to normalcy

- Advertisement -

It is a great news that the daily withdrawal limit from ATM has been increased to Rs.10000 from the earlier Rs.4500 limit. It is a good sign that there is vast improvement in note flow and RBI has taken drastic measures to bring about the change after demonetisation in good time. However, many ATMs are not functioning due to calibration problem and thereby reducing the chances of withdrawal of money through the Automated Teller Machines. Thus the withdrawal limit is increased to more than double but RBI has retained the weekly ceiling at Rs 24,000 with the supply of more five hundred notes. Now, it is time to make the ATMs work 24X7 time so that people’s problem will be partially solved and banks will have more time to attend their customers and broaden their business base rather than concentrating on cash all the time. Anyway, after demonetisation there has been a surge in bank deposits. Thus notes ban has served the purpose of the Government to reach the poor in the best way possible.

Jayanthy S. Maniam
